Who assumes the role of Technical Advisor and Chairperson over the Public Safety Advisory Board?

Explanation:
The correct answer is the Intelligence Division Commander, who serves as the Technical Advisor and Chairperson over the Public Safety Advisory Board. This role is pivotal because the Intelligence Division Commander typically oversees the coordination and gathering of intelligence relevant to public safety matters. They provide critical insights and guidance on various issues that the board tackles, leveraging their expertise in data analysis and strategic planning to enhance public safety initiatives. In this capacity, the Intelligence Division Commander is well-equipped to facilitate discussions, lead meetings, and ensure that recommendations made by the board are grounded in comprehensive understanding and assessment of the safety needs of the community. Their position allows them to integrate various sources of information, making them essential for effective public safety governance. The other roles listed, such as the Chief of Police, Watch Lieutenant, and Risk Management Director, have their distinct responsibilities within law enforcement and public safety, but they do not fulfill the specific function of chairing the Public Safety Advisory Board and providing technical advisement as effectively as the Intelligence Division Commander.
